Median Household Income by Age of Householder in Breitung Township, Minnesota (2021, in 2022 inflation-adjusted dollars)
This table presents the distribution of median household income among distinct age brackets of householders in Breitung township. Based on the latest 5-Year estimates from the American Community Survey, it displays how income varies among householders of different ages in Breitung township.
Age Of The Head Of Household | Median Household Income |
---|---|
Under 25 years | - |
25 to 44 years | $95,031 |
45 to 64 years | $93,567 |
65 years and over | $52,947 |

Analysis of income trends over the past decade highlights notable shifts across various age groups. Among the three age groups with available Census data in both 2011 and 2021, two groups encountered a decline in their median household income, while the remaining one experienced an increase during this period. Notably, household income for individuals within the 25 to 44 years age group demonstrated a remarkable increase of $9,733(11.41%), escalating from a median of $85,298 in 2011 to $95,031 in 2021. Conversely, the age group of 65 years and over years witnessed the most significant decline in household income across the same span. Their median income saw a substantial drop of $29,908(36.10%), declining from a median of $82,855 in 2011 to $52,947 in 2021.
Breitung Township, Minnesota household income distribution across age groups
To gain a comprehensive understanding of the financial landscape within the Breitung township population, we conducted an analysis of household incomes across 16 distinct brackets within four age cohorts: under 25 years, 25 to 44 years, 45 to 64 years, and over 65 years.
Upon closer examination of the distribution of households among age brackets, it reveals that there are 25(6.87%) households where the householder is under 25 years old, 55(15.11%) households with a householder aged between 25 and 44 years, 169(46.43%) households with a householder aged between 45 and 64 years, and 115(31.59%) households where the householder is over 65 years old.
The age group of 25 to 44 years exhibits the highest median household income, while the largest number of households falls within the 45 to 64 years bracket.
